ESPN fires employee over racist Jeremy Lin headline LOS ANGELES, Feb 19 (TheWrap.com) - ESPN has fired one employee and suspended another for using the same racist word in connection to New York Knicks' guard Jeremy Lin. In both cases, an employee used the word "chink" in reference to Lin, a Palo Alto, California, native of Chinese descent. "We again apologize, especially to Mr. Lin," ESPN wrote. ESPN crackdown after 'racist' Jeremy Lin pun Anthony Federico was sacked for writing a caption reading "A Chink in the Armour" following the New York Knicks' first loss since basketball phenomenon Lin joined the team.
